About Piyush Kumar Singh

Piyush Kumar Singh, With an exceptional h-index of 9 and a recent h-index of 8 (since 2020), a distinguished researcher at University of Illinois at Urbana-Champaign, specializes in the field of Soft Matter, polymer physics, rheology, polymer blend phase behavior, multi-phase flows.

His recent articles reflect a diverse array of research interests and contributions to the field:

Unification of physical interpretation of MAOS responses via experimentally decomposed material functions

Unexpected Slow Relaxation Dynamics in Pure Ring Polymers Arise from Intermolecular Interactions

Designing Multicomponent Polymer Colloids for Self-Stratifying Films

Revisiting the basis of transient rheological material functions: insights from recoverable strain measurements

Elucidating the G″ overshoot in soft materials with a yield transition via a time-resolved experimental strain decomposition
